Description
The School Management System for Wordpress plugin for WordPress is vulnerable to arbitrary file uploads due to missing file type validation in the mj_smgt_user_avatar_image_upload() function in all versions up to, and including, 91.5.0. This makes it possible for unauthenticated attackers to upload arbitrary files on the affected site's server which may make remote code execution possible.
Comprehensive Technical Analysis of CVE-2024-9659
1. Vulnerability Assessment and Severity Evaluation
CVE ID: CVE-2024-9659 CISA Vulnerability Name: CVE-2024-9659 CVSS Score: 9.8
The vulnerability in the School Management System for WordPress plugin allows for arbitrary file uploads due to the lack of file type validation in the mj_smgt_user_avatar_image_upload() function. This flaw is present in all versions up to and including 91.5.0. The CVSS score of 9.8 indicates a critical severity, highlighting the potential for significant impact if exploited.
2. Potential Attack Vectors and Exploitation Methods
Attack Vectors:
- Unauthenticated File Upload: Attackers can exploit this vulnerability without needing any authentication, making it a high-risk vector.
- Remote Code Execution (RCE): By uploading malicious files (e.g., PHP scripts), attackers can execute arbitrary code on the server, leading to full server compromise.
Exploitation Methods:
- File Upload: An attacker can craft a request to the vulnerable endpoint, bypassing the file type validation and uploading a malicious file.
- Code Execution: Once the file is uploaded, the attacker can trigger its execution, potentially leading to data exfiltration, server control, or further malware deployment.

4. Recommended Mitigation Strategies
Immediate Actions:
- Update the Plugin: Ensure that the plugin is updated to a version that includes a fix for this vulnerability.
- Disable the Plugin: If an update is not available, consider disabling the plugin until a patched version is released.
Long-Term Mitigations:
- Implement File Type Validation: Ensure that all file uploads are validated for allowed file types.
- Use Web Application Firewalls (WAF): Deploy WAFs to monitor and block suspicious file upload attempts.
- Regular Security Audits: Conduct regular security audits and code reviews to identify and mitigate similar vulnerabilities.
